Winners Named In Religious Story Telling Contest
By Hj Mohd Nordin

Bandar Seri Begawan - The final of story telling competition was held in conjunction with the Islamic New Year 1426 at the Omar Ali Saifuddien Mosque in Bandar Seri Begawan.

The guest of honour was Dato Paduka Awang Hj Abdul Rahman bin Hj Mohiddin, Permanent Secretary at the Ministry of Religious Affairs.

The aim of the competition was to encourage children to participate in the celebration of significant days in the Islamic calendar, especially the Islamic New Year, by exemplifying the Islamic stories.

This will instill a healthy set of morals in the children. The competition was also aimed at exposing children to organisational commitments and spontaneous public speaking at a young age to shape them into devout Muslims.

A total of 65 children aged 12 and below, from Al-Quran and Muqaddam classes at mosques and suraus participated in, while seven "exceptional" participants were chosen to enter the competition.

The competition was organised by the Ministry of Religious Affairs through the Mosque Affairs Department in cooperation with the Islamic Eminence Development and Communication Section. -- Courtesy of Borneo Bulletin
